+        if (!callbacks_.empty()) {
+          auto cb = callbacks_.front();
+          callbacks_.pop();
+          lock.unlock();
+          cb();
+        } else if (shutdown_) {
+          return;
+        }
+      }
+    }));
+  }
+}
+
+ThreadPool::~ThreadPool() {
+  {
+    std::lock_guard<std::mutex> lock(mu_);
+    shutdown_ = true;
+    cv_.notify_all();
+  }
+  for (auto& t : threads_) {
+    t.join();
+  }
+}
+
+void ThreadPool::ScheduleCallback(const std::function<void()>& callback) {
+  std::lock_guard<std::mutex> lock(mu_);
+  callbacks_.push(callback);
+  cv_.notify_all();
+}
+
+}  // namespace grpc
